vue子組件向父組件傳值 vue父組件中調(diào)用子組件函數(shù)的方法?
vue父組件中調(diào)用子組件函數(shù)的方法?<!--編輯成員--><edituser ref=“edituser”v-on:childmethod=“parentmethod”></edi
vue父組件中調(diào)用子組件函數(shù)的方法?
<!--編輯成員--><edituser ref=“edituser”v-on:childmethod=“parentmethod”></edituser>12<script>import edituser from”/編輯.vue導(dǎo)出默認值{data(){return{}},方法:{parentMethod(param){控制臺.log(“parent”)},}}</script>
使用$emit觸發(fā)父組件的事件,父組件將偵聽此事件。使用此$父.xxxx這樣,就可以直接調(diào)用父組件的方法。
vue子組件怎么調(diào)用父組件的方法?
Vue組件的數(shù)據(jù)傳輸應(yīng)該是單向的,總是向下的,并且將父組件的屬性方法傳輸?shù)阶咏M件。如果子組件想要更改不同的顏色,它應(yīng)該接受父組件傳入的props,調(diào)用它自己的方法,并使用props作為參數(shù)來確定要顯示的顏色,而不是讓父元素調(diào)整子組件。